I think you are mixing up a couple of things.
Income to rent ratio, which is what this thread is about, varies geographically. Rent eats 30-40% of income in prestige cities like NYC or SF or LA. It's only 25% in Kansas City or Columbus.
You seem to be thinking about overall cost burden over time.
